These include you basic office applications such a word processor, spreadsheet presentation software, a database development application and sometime an email client. The standard has always been Microsoft Office - which includes Microsoft Word for a word processor, Microsoft Excel for a Spreadsheet, Microsoft PowerPoint for presentation software, Microsoft Outlook for a mail client and Microsoft Access for a database development application. You can check out Microsoft Office here: http://office.microsoft.com All of the applications are wonderful, but with a price tag of several hundred dollars for this suite, you got to be kicking your self in the head not to at least try something different. Here are the alternatives: Star Office - Cheap and good Open Office - Free and good StarOffice is produced by Sun Microsystems and did very well at a price of $69.95 StarOffice Writer is the word processor, StarOffice Calc is the spreadsheet. StarOffice Impress is the presentation software. StarOffice Base is the database development application. There are two more applications included in this suite StarOffice Draw is a flowchart drawing application which let you draw organizational charts, topology diagrams and sketches, The last application is called enterprise tools which enables you to secure your documents by using digital data signatures and Deliver functionality to all users through advanced accessibility features. You can check out StarOffice here: http://www.sun.com/software/star/staroffice/get.jsp OpenOffice is a completely 100% free office package, it is designed as open source meaning that anyone can get it and help develop it. OpenOffice Writer s the word processor, OpenOffice Calc is the spreadsheet. OpenOffice Impress is the presentation software. OpenOffice Draw is a drawing program which lets you produce anything from flow charts to 3D illustrations. OpenOffice Base is the database development application and OpenOffice Math is a neat program which lets you create mathematical equations using a graphical user interface and an equation editor. You can check out OpenOffice here: http://www.openoffice.org The only thing these 2 suites are lacking is a mail client to compete with Microsoft Outlook. Here are the alternatives for those: Outlook Express - Free Eudora - Free Thunderbird - Free Outlook Express - a great email client which already comes with all versions of Microsoft Windows. Outlook Express is available for both Windows and Mac and is bundled with Internet Explorer (A web browser produced by Microsoft) you can read more about Outlook Express here: http://www.microsoft.com/windows/ie/ie6/using/oe/default.mspx Eudora - A free mail client by produced by Qualcomm, very stable and easy to use it supports both Mac and Windows operating Systems. You can read more about Eudora here: http://www.eudora.com Thunderbird - A free mail client put out by Mozilla, very easy to use, self intuitive and does not eat lots of system resources. You can download Thunderbird here: http://www.mozilla.com/en-US/thunderbird GIMP - GIMP is the GNU Image Manipulation Program. It is a freely distributed piece of software for such tasks as photo retouching, image composition and image authoring. It works on many operating systems, in many languages.
